THE COMPETITION:
The PAP competition is one of the biggest and most prestigious architectural design competition to be held in Africa. The new Pan African Parliament building will be built in Randjesfontein, Midrand, South Africa. The new PAP building will symbolise the coming of age of the African continent and will represent the diverse cultures of Africa, while expressing itself as a heart of democracy in Africa.
